SDK Initialization¶
The recommended way to initialize the SDK is by adding a License key in the AndroidManifest.xml
file.
<meta-data
android:name="com.microblink.recognition.License"
android:value="LICENSE KEY" />
By doing so, our content provider will be used, and it will automatically initialize all that is necessary for the SDK to work.
Manual initialization¶
If you want to manually initialize the SDK, first, you should remove our content provider from the AndroidManifest.xml
file, as shown in the snippet below.
<provider
android:name="com.microblink.recognition.core.RecognitionProvider"
android:authorities="${applicationId}.RecognitionProvider"
tools:node="remove" />
After that, you should call BlinkRecognitionSdk.initialize()
to initialize the SDK. There are a couple of ways how this can be achieved, we recommend using App Startup. Another way is to add the initialization code in the Application
class in the onCreate
method.
The license key should be set in AndroidManifest.xml
as mentioned in the section above.
